What drew to the M.A. in Arts Politics?
I was curious about how I might develop a praxis that combined my interest in politics with art. Until then, I really had always been taught to keep these ideas separated.

How did your experience in the program shape your work?

I found a better language to describe my work; I feel like I better understand the ecosystems that I live within, too.

What are some of the challenges and/or rewards of this program?

It was a major life change to come from Virginia's rural Blue Ridge Mountain into Downtown Manhattan. I appreciated the convergence of so many diverse voices, energies, times, and goals. The program is fast paced, like the city! I had to learn to be a tad slower when I went onto do my MFA.
